About Wrist Pain

Wrist pain can follow a fall, begin gradually with repetitive use, or appear as numbness and weakness rather than simple soreness. The wrist contains eight carpal bones, the distal radius and ulna, the TFCC cartilage complex, multiple stabilizing ligaments, tendons, and nerves, so accurate diagnosis matters.

Mountain Spine & Orthopedics evaluates wrist pain by mechanism and location: thumb-side pain, small-finger-side pain, central dorsal pain, palm-side numbness, post-fall swelling, clicking, or loss of grip strength. That pattern helps separate fracture, ligament instability, carpal tunnel syndrome, De Quervain's tenosynovitis, TFCC injury, tendonitis, ganglion cyst, and arthritis.

What Are the Symptoms of Wrist Pain?

Wrist symptoms often point to a specific structure:

  • Pain after a fall on an outstretched hand: May indicate distal radius, scaphoid, or other carpal fracture
  • Thumb-side pain: Can suggest De Quervain's, thumb arthritis, or scaphoid injury
  • Small-finger-side pain: Raises concern for TFCC injury or ulnar-sided tendon problems
  • Clicking, clunking, or giving way: May indicate ligament instability
  • Numbness or tingling: Suggests nerve compression such as carpal tunnel syndrome
  • Morning stiffness or swelling: May suggest inflammatory or degenerative arthritis

Are There Specific Risk Factors for Wrist Pain?

Risk factors include falls, contact or board sports, gymnastics, racquet sports, weightlifting, repetitive gripping or typing, prior fracture, inflammatory arthritis, diabetes or thyroid disease associated with nerve compression, and age-related ligament or cartilage degeneration.

Diagnosing Wrist Pain?

Diagnosis begins with location-specific tenderness, wrist motion, grip strength, neurologic testing, and stability maneuvers such as scaphoid tenderness, Watson testing, Finkelstein testing, TFCC compression, and carpal tunnel provocative tests.

Treatment for Wrist Pain?

Non-Surgical Treatment

Treatment may include splinting, bracing, activity changes, anti-inflammatory medication when appropriate, outside rehabilitation guidance, and image-guided injections for selected tendon, nerve, or arthritis problems.

Surgical Options

Surgery depends on the diagnosis and may include wrist arthroscopy for TFCC or ligament injuries, fracture fixation for unstable fractures, carpal tunnel release for persistent nerve compression, or fusion/reconstruction for advanced arthritis or instability.

Does Wrist Pain Cause Pain?

Bone pain after injury, nerve symptoms in the fingers, tendon pain with a specific motion, and deep joint pain with stiffness all require different workups. Persistent pain after a fall deserves particular attention because scaphoid and ligament injuries can be missed on early X-rays.

What Can Patients Do to Prevent It?

Prevention Tips

  • Use proper technique and equipment during sports and work activities
  • Take regular breaks during repetitive tasks
  • Strengthen wrist and forearm muscles with targeted exercises
  • Use ergonomic tools and maintain neutral wrist position when typing
  • Wear wrist guards during activities with fall risk

Frequently Asked Questions

What are the most common causes of wrist pain?

Common causes include sprains and strains, tendinitis (like De Quervain's), carpal tunnel syndrome, TFCC tears, arthritis, and fractures. Accurate diagnosis is important because treatment varies significantly.

When should I see a doctor for wrist pain?

See a specialist if wrist pain persists beyond a few weeks, follows an injury with swelling or deformity, includes numbness or tingling, or significantly limits your activities. Immediate evaluation is needed after trauma with severe pain or inability to move the wrist.

Can wrist pain be a sign of carpal tunnel syndrome?

What tests diagnose the cause of wrist pain?

Diagnosis includes physical examination and specific provocation tests. X-rays evaluate bones and arthritis. MRI visualizes soft tissues, ligaments, and cartilage. Ultrasound assesses tendons. Nerve conduction studies diagnose nerve compression.

What treatments are available for chronic wrist pain?

Treatment depends on the cause and may include splinting, anti-inflammatory medications, rehabilitation, and injections. When conservative care fails, surgical options range from wrist arthroscopy to fracture fixation to joint fusion or replacement.
